Abstract
The liquid–liquid equilibrium (LLE) of the ternary system water + acetic acid + butyl butanoate has been determined experimentally at room temperature. The phase diagrams were obtained by determining the solubility and tie-line data. GCEOS, NRTL and UNIQUAC models were used to predict the LLE data with a root-mean-square deviation value of 0.1314, 0.0938 and 0.2955, respectively. The reliability of the experimental tie-line data were obtained by Othmer–Tobias correlation. Distribution coefficient and separation factor were evaluated for the immiscibility region of the ternary system.
